Here&#8217;s how: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>With the drive installed in the new location, open Disk Management (type <strong>disk management<\/strong> in the cortana\/search box; select the offered tool). You&#8217;ll see a graphic representation of all your system&#8217;s drives.  Select the target drive (the one you want to repartition); right click on any partition listed on that drive and select <strong><em>Delete volume<\/em><\/strong>. Repeat for all other partitions on that drive until the entire space is shown as <strong><em>Unallocated<\/em><\/strong>. Right-click anywhere on the unallocated space; select <strong><em>New simple volume<\/em><\/strong>, and follow the steps. When it\u2019s offered, select <strong><em>Quick format<\/em>.<\/strong> You\u2019re done!<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Your entire old drive is now fully returned to service.
